I have these Junfac's on both of my wraiths. The only thing I can complain/share about these is that those little C rings (don't know what they're called) that are supposed to hold the crosspins in, don't. Edit: By "don't", i mean that the opening on the "C rings" rattle around until the pin can pop out of the opening, allowing the shaft to slide off un-noticed). No pics, hard at work not working! I've lost shafts on trails but after some quick backtracking found the pieces and was able to repair with no tools at all. It happened to my other wraith over this past camping trip... not fun when you're already a few miles up the mountain trail! I'll be pulling them and heat shrinking the crosspins in to place with a heavy shrink wrap, hopefully that'll hold. (Better idea? Do share!!!!)
